3D Printing in Dental Surgery
To enhance the area of oral surgery, you can check out the subtopic of 3D printing in oral surgery. This ingenious modern technology has the potential to change the method dental specialists run and treat patients. Right here are four crucial methods which 3D printing is shaping the field:
- ** Custom-made Surgical Guides **: 3D printing enables the creation of very accurate and patient-specific medical overviews, improving the precision and efficiency of treatments.
- ** Implant Prosthetics **: With 3D printing, oral specialists can create personalized dental implant prosthetics that completely fit a person's one-of-a-kind makeup, leading to much better end results and client satisfaction.
-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, reducing the need for conventional implanting methods and improving recovery and healing time.
- ** Education and Educating **: 3D printing can be used to develop sensible medical versions for educational functions, allowing dental surgeons to practice complex treatments before doing them on individuals.
With its possible to improve precision, modification, and training, 3D printing is an amazing growth in the field of oral surgery.
Minimally Invasive Methods
To additionally advance the area of oral surgery, accept the capacity of minimally intrusive techniques that can considerably profit both doctors and individuals alike.
Minimally intrusive strategies are changing the area by minimizing medical trauma, lessening post-operative pain, and accelerating the recovery procedure. These methods include using smaller incisions and specialized tools to do procedures with accuracy and effectiveness.
By making use of sophisticated imaging technology, such as cone light beam calculated tomography (CBCT), cosmetic surgeons can precisely prepare and execute surgical procedures with marginal invasiveness.
In addition, using lasers in dental surgery enables precise tissue cutting and coagulation, causing lessened blood loss and decreased healing time.
With minimally intrusive techniques, people can experience faster healing, minimized scarring, and improved end results, making it an important aspect of the future of oral surgery.
